Flights are booked so now we're looking for somewhere to stay :sunny:
I'd originally planned to look at Windsor Hills or somewhere else close to WDW.
I've been having second thoughts and, as we intend to spend a few days at Universal (and will be staying the first 5 nights at All Stars Music anyway) I've been considering somewhere like Vista Cay or Parc Corniche - has anyone stayed at either of them? Alternatively does anyone have any other ideas?

Without a doubt, Wyndhams Bonnet Creek. Situated between caribbean beach and Typhoon Lagoon. lost count of the number of times I have stayed there (see signature)the last being the August just gone. wouldn't stay anywhere else. Never had a single bad moment there. If you go over to the Orlando Hotels and Attractions board, you will see loads of stuff about Bonnet Creek. I have always booked with Ken and Denise Price at www.vacationupgrades.com. They are wonderful. Don't be put off by there website, it looks a bit old fashioned. Just call them. You will see lots of excellent reports for them. For pictures just look on booking.com or tripadvisor. Lots there. 6 pools, 2 lazy rivers, mini golf, lots of entertainment. Very large apartments. Loads for the kids to do. Feel free to ask any other questions.
 
Same here, our fave place is WBC. Last time I booked with Ken & Denise, paid about £70/nt for a 2 bed. 100% better than the 2 bed we had at Windsor Hills, didn't like the apartment or the location.

Oh ok, but just to let you know, pretty easy drive from WBC to Universal. We do it all the time. I go the back way down S Apopka Vineland Road > Sandlake > Turkey Lake. Never run into traffic. The facilities and price at Bonnet Creek far outway saving 15 minutes on the journey to Universal, especailly if also going to Disney. Last August we only went to MK once for the Halloween Party. Other than that we didn't have Disney tickets.
